Version 13.0 of Project Zip Code software is
now available for download.
Wisconsin credit unions are encouraged to take a few moments to download
this program, which safely assesses the presence of your credit union
members in each zip code. This information can be crucial in
illustrating credit unions’ impact in each legislative district
and Wisconsin overall.
Twice a year, credit unions should use the latest Project Zip Code software and your member database to help demonstrate credit unions'
statewide and nationwide presence. No identifying member information is
revealed, but your results can inform legislators how many credit union
members are constituents, giving credit unions a stronger
voice.
"Credit unions are deeply ingrained in
communities across the state, with more than 40% of the state population
belonging to a credit union," said League VP of Government Affairs Tom
Liebe. "Project Zip Code data powerfully illustrates that credit union
members represent a huge base of potential support for any legislator
and legislation related to credit unions directly affects a great deal
of their constituencies."
Project Zip Code, which provides
credit union member totals for the 113th Congress and state
legislative districts, can also be helpful in internal decision making,
including identifying communities that would benefit from new ATM or
branch locations.
